Output 23d5bc7be13eed3b14950fffd14795f86e76e43700083f6b58ca2fcb08b5d558:6

value
5733773
script pubkey
OP_0 OP_PUSHBYTES_20 bb68a459eea8ded004141d7201f33fa04db15d75
address
bc1qhd52gk0w4r0dqpq5r4eqruel5pxmzht4e0syqs
transaction
23d5bc7be13eed3b14950fffd14795f86e76e43700083f6b58ca2fcb08b5d558
spent
true